Torre Mozza

Torre Mozza beach, famous for its namesake- a dominant tower from 1550- and the surrounding sand dunes and sea grass provide natural beauty and incredible charm.

ISOLA D’Elba

Isola D’Elba is an island in the Tuscan Archipelago National Park and, with its rugged nature and crystal clear sea, is one of the most beautiful and fascinating islands in the Mediterranean; to be discovered in every corner and throughout all seasons.

Bolgheri

In the inland of the Coast of Etruschi, the small village of Bolgheri awaits. Developed around a medieval castle that stands on a hill, it that can be reached by a charming avenue of cypresses that begins in the valley just in front of the eighteenth-century Oratorio di San Guido.

MASSA MARITTIMA

Perched on a high and isolated hill, the historic centre of Massa Marittima soars within a well-preserved city wall. The narrow streets that cross the hill lead to a picturesque viewpoint, where you can admire this breathtaking and timeless place.

PARCO ARCHEOLOGICO DI BARATTI E POPULONIA

The park stretches between the slopes of the cape of Piombino and the Gulf of Baratti, where the Etruscan and Roman city of Populonia stood. Here, it is possible to discover the Roman city, built in the second century BC. The Etruscan acropolis of the IX-VIII century B.C. and the necropolis is connected by a network of paths that descend from the cape to the bay of the gulf.
